Our 5 Tips To Help You Improve Mental Focus!
– Meditation – Meditation Enables the body to relax and distress. Being relaxed enables the body to function optimally and allows the bodies cognitive ability to work to its highest ability without getting clouded and forgetful!
– Listening to music – Music has a calming affect as well as increasing a persons motivation. This in turn will help with overall productivity and goal setting!
– Memory Exercises – Anything that challenges the mind such as a simple game of chess or Sudoku can help improve cognitive function. Being productive in some way will help stop you from getting forgetful!
– Improve/Change Sleeping Habits – Setting an alarm and turning off electronic devices before sleeping can make a big difference in cognitive function and mental focus. Setting a sleep schedule will enable you to get in your 7+ hours per day weekly and stop you from staying up to late
– A Healthy Diet – A diet that is low in sugars will help drastically with mental focus. Sugars can crash a persons mood especially when High-GI foods are in the mix. This can lead to a decrease in productivity and mental focus! Therefore sticking to whole foods such as meats and vegetables and looking for Low-GI alternatives are a great way to set up your mental focus for the better!

The Achilles tendon is a strong band of fibrous tissue which joins the muscles of your calf [Gastrocnemius & soleus] to the heel bone [calcaneus]
The achilles tendon stands as the strongest & largest tendon in the body and serves the function of transmitting power from the calf into the heel and foot. Therefore the achilles tendon plays and important in everyday activities such as walking, running and jumping
This tendon can withstand very high forces, however due to it’s limited blood supply, is very susceptible to injury. Injuries can include tendonitis’, tears, ruptures and bursitis’
Symptoms of an achilles injury include swelling at the tendon, pain with weight-bearing and stiffness at the ankle. Here are some exercises that you can perform to help speed up your recovery rate
